Intraluminal echoes are sound wave reflections within a hollow structure, such as a blood vessel or an organ, that are seen on imaging studies like ultrasound. These echoes can provide information about the composition and characteristics of the structure being examined.

Intraluminal refers to something situated within the space or lumen of a tubular structure in the body, such as a blood vessel or intestine. It is often used to describe things like catheters or obstructions that are inside a tubular space.
